Le sablier, symbole facile du temps, dont on voudrait tantôt qu'il dure et tantôt qu'il s'arrête ; le temps, parfois notre ennemi et parfois notre ami... Si l'on pense à son étranglement, qu'un grain de sable bien calibré ne saurait pas obstruer, si l'on pense à la disproportionnalité- loi universelle à mon gré- entre la plage immense et le grain unique, on peut être pris d'un vertige obsédant. Disproportionnalité encore entre la fluidité du sable qui s'écoule et le malaise du grain dans la chaussure, sous la paupière, ou plus grave sa faculté d'enrayer la machine !

Born December 23, 1942 in Heliopolis near Cairo (Egypt).

Painting lessons with Angelo de Ritz. Arrived in France in 1959.

Entrance examination to the Beaux-Arts in 1963. Bachelor of letters at Paris la Sorbonne. Three master classes with Salvador Dali at the Hotel Meurisse, Paris in 1967.

According to the destination of my biography I can classify myself as "autodidact"...

Stayed in Tel Aviv (Israel) from 1969 to 1974 where I taught drawing and worked as an interior designer.

Many participations in various fairs and numerous prizes.

I got my own "Opus 31" at the Marché Dauphine in St-Ouen from 1990 to 2000; I exhibited and sold my works exclusively there.

I permanently exhibit in my studio; it's my studio-housing, I receive visitors there by appointment by phone or message.
